Team USA artistic swimmer Anita Alvarez is heading to Paris to compete in her third consecutive Olympic Games this summer following her performance in the team and duet events at the World Aquatic Championships in Doha.
This marks the U.S. artistic swimming team’s first Olympic appearance in the team event since 2008.

LEWISVILLE, Texas – The Wheaton College (Mass.) artistic swimming team placed fifth at the Collegiate National Championship following events on the final day of the title meet at Westside Aquatic Center in Lewisville, Texas.
The Lyons tallied 58.5 points over the two-day championship, finishing just a point and a half out of fourth place. University of the Incarnate Word won the crown with 95 points after placing third a year ago. The ten teams and 18 duets quota spots have been announced for the 2024 Paris Olympics for artistic swimming. Artistic swimming will take place from August 5-10 in Paris.
Team
10 countries with eight athletes each (and one reserve athlete each) will compete at the 2024 Paris Olympics in the team event. Men will be allowed to compete for the first time in the Olympics, but each team can have a maximum of two men for the team competition.

With a bronze-medal finish in the mixed team acrobatic routine at the 2024 World Championships in Doha, Qatar, the United States qualified its artistic swimming team for the Olympics for the first time since 2008.
There were five Olympic berths available for artistic swimming teams at Worlds this year, determined by the aggregate total of their performances in the acrobatic routine, free routine, and technical routine. After already winning the team acrobatic and team technical World Titles, China took home gold in the team free artistic swimming event on Friday, February 9th in Doha.
Team Free Results
China 339.7604
Japan 315.2229
USA 304.9021

Artistic swimmers Nargiza Bolatova and Eduard Kim made history for Kazakhstan on Sunday with the nation’s first ever gold medal at the World Aquatics Championships in the mixed duet technical event.
Bolatova and Kim rallied from 4th in prelims to win with 228.005 points, just ahead of China’s Cheng Wentao and Shi Haoyu (223.3166). They performed their routine to the theme of Tim Burton’s animated musical fantasy, “Corpse Bride.”
